Our focus is on h-refinement with a fixed polynomial order. The algorithm handles triangular, quadrilateral, hexahedral and prismatic meshes of arbitrarily high order curvature, for any order finite element space in the de Rham sequence. We present a flexible data structure for meshes with hanging nodes and a general procedure to construct the conforming interpolation operator, both in serial and in parallel.
